Honey-Soy Steak
Ingredients
- 1 Tablespoon olive oil
- 1 Tablespoon honey
- 1 Tablespoon soy sauce
- 2 large cloves garlic finely chopped
- ½ 1 lime
- 1 pound sirloin steak
- ½ Tablespoon butter
Instructions
- Mix first 5 ingredients together in a bowl.
- Cube steak into 1 inch chunks. Put all into a baggie and shake well. Let steak marinate for about 20 minutes. Allow a cast iron skillet to get hot and add butter, once melted add steak into single layer. Allow to sear undisturbed for 1 minute. Flip over and cook on other side. May take 4-5 minutes to cook through. Remove and top on salad or rice.
